Output ec0df8031006cb2efcf2d1b142d805fcbede776c6cc83f398e368758405f632b:0

value
2562788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 606251663925566d484a5184950a49af2c99669a OP_EQUAL
address
3AUeaDDnqRX7NYJJZKzWhEnrzhSeFwWzoB
transaction
ec0df8031006cb2efcf2d1b142d805fcbede776c6cc83f398e368758405f632b